This is there proposed line-up. I think you'll agree it leaves a few questions.

Isaac Peach v.s TBA
Warren Fuiava v.s Joseph Kwadjo
Joseph Parker v.s TBA
Robbie Berridge v.s Daniel Mckinnon
Chauncy Welliver v.s TBA
Solomon Haumono v.s Joey Wilson
Shane Cameron v.s Monte Barrett

Cracking card if it comes off but Mckinnon is fighting Powncenby in a couple of weeks and Chauncy is fighting Sherman Williams in Macau on the 28th June.

I'm doubtful Chauncy will fight, have heard rumours of other names also but will obviously have to sit back wait and see.

I think Fuiava VS Kwadjo will be a good fight, probably only over 6-8 rounds both guys deserve a 10-12 rounder good fight none the less.

IF Berridge Vs McKinnon comes off that is another good fight once again probably only over 6-8 rounds once again deserves to be 10-12 with something at stake.

Isaac Peach im not that excited about, cant punch and generally in scrappy ugly fights, be interesting to see who hes matched with. At least hes in shape and looks the part.

Haumono vs Wilson, 2 big heavys going at it but i think Solo should have to much for Joey. Big Joey is tough but unless he gets onot the front foot and starts fighting with purpose i think Solo backs him up all night with joey bocing going backwards and getting stopped late or beaten on points. Decent Heavyweight scrap.

Joesph Parkers pro debut is obviously an attraction depending on who he is matched with of course, that probably wont be announced until closer to fight night as I cant see him being put in with anyone to strong just yet.

Would of liked to have seen some room made for the likes of Steve Heremaia, one of our better fighters
